I recently had a discussion/debate with a few guys while waiting to tee off... The premise of the discussion was simply... Do the specialty run discs really make a difference?

It was interesting i got 5 different answers and contrasting views.

- "They can, but it's the thrower not the disc."
- "Absolutely, when you figure out <when> you need them they make a huge difference.
- "No, i dont like to rely on a disc i might not find again."
- "absolutely, obviously you have tried a <X> disc" <- (CE Eagle)
- Sometimes, but is it worth the hassle?

My Answer
- "Absolutely, but not all of them. But when you find one that is good, it does make a clear difference.

-------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
My Analysis (reviews of disc runs)

Things i would recommend:
Champion Roc
Champion Glow Gazelle
Champion Glow Firebird (if you can handle it)

[Champion] Teerex-X (a more overstable Wraith....moved up to Destroyer, never looked back)
Champion XD (Not sure it really is anything more than a more durable version)

Champion Gator (did not make much of a difference)
Champion (gummy) Rhyno (not much of a difference - mine, not very floppy)
Cryztal Buzzz (Nice, but not sure it was worth the hassle and made enough of a difference)
(Wood) Aviar - (No difference, other than the Disc smelled like wood. - Yes i smelled it,)

Different runs can fly different. Hell they can be a different mold. Look at all the variations the TeeRex has gone through. But the enviroment the discs cool in can affect stability, speed and glide so specific runs do have an effect. That said, I don't like to throw anything rare/tough to replace so I don't bother with them even if they're the best thing ever.
